]> git.karo-electronics.de Git - karo-tx-linux.git/blobdiff - include/linux/usb/hcd.h
usb: separate out sysdev pointer from usb_bus
[karo-tx-linux.git] / include / linux / usb / hcd.h
index dff1301512352efe726d7b8681a8d346e495ade2..a469999a106dbc1869f7c90eccc313a90a6d17b0 100644 (file)
@@ -437,6 +437,9 @@ extern int usb_hcd_alloc_bandwidth(struct usb_device *udev,
                struct usb_host_interface *new_alt);
 extern int usb_hcd_get_frame_number(struct usb_device *udev);
 
+struct usb_hcd *__usb_create_hcd(const struct hc_driver *driver,
+               struct device *sysdev, struct device *dev, const char *bus_name,
+               struct usb_hcd *primary_hcd);
 extern struct usb_hcd *usb_create_hcd(const struct hc_driver *driver,
                struct device *dev, const char *bus_name);
 extern struct usb_hcd *usb_create_shared_hcd(const struct hc_driver *driver,